The common goal of all vaccines developed against COVID-19, although they have been designed with different methods, is to develop an effective immunity and antibody response against SARS-CoV-2. However, the postvaccination immune response and antibody levels differ between individuals. This study examined the relationship between postvaccine seropositivity rates, age, gender, smoking, and body mass index (BMI), and antibody titers. A total of 314 healthcare workers (HCW) who were not previously infected with COVID-19 and who had received two doses of CoronaVac inactivated vaccine participated in the study. Seropositivity against the receptor-binding domain (RBD) of the SARS-CoV-2 spike protein was measured from the participants 4 weeks after the second dose of vaccine using the electrochemiluminescence (ECLIA) method. In addition, the antibody developed against the nucleocapsid protein (NCP) was evaluated and compared using Elecsys Anti-SARS-CoV-2 kit. One hundred and eighty-one of the participants were female (57.6%) with a median age of 39 (interquartile range [IQR], 10) and 133 (42.4%) were male with a median age of 41 (IQR, 11). 99.6% of the volunteers developed seropositivity 4 weeks after the second dose of vaccine. It was also observed that the rate of RBD protein antibody titer was >250 U/ml in smokers, which is quite low compared to nonsmokers (p = 0.032), and that high RBD antibody titers were proportionally lower in obese participants, according to BMI values, compared to those with normal BMI (49.5% and 9.9%). It was observed that seropositivity developed in almost all participants after the CoronaVac vaccine. However, it was determined that the antibody titer measured varied depending on factors such as smoking, BMI, and duration.

Infections with Nocardia species are generally seen in immunocompromised subjects. In this report, we present a case of pleuropulmonary and skin Nocardia cyriacigeorgici infection in a male patient with Behcet's disease who used corticosteroids and immunosupressives for a long period of time. He died before the diagnosis of Nocardia infection was made.

BACKGROUND: Crimean-Congo hemorrhagic fever (CCHF) causes endothelial activation and dysfunction by affecting the endothelium directly or indirectly. In maintaining the vascular integrity, vascular endothelial growth factor (VEGF-A) and its receptor (VEGFR1) and angiopoietin-2 (Ang-2) and its receptor (Tie-2) are very important mediators. For this reason, we aimed at studying the association of Ang-2 and VEGF and their receptors Tie-2 and VEGFR1 with CCHF infection. METHODS: Thirty one CCHF patients and 31 healthy controls (HC) were included in the study. CCHF patients were classified into 2 groups in terms of disease severity (severe and nonsevere). VEGF-A, VEGFR1, Ang-2 and Tie-2 levels were measured in all groups. RESULT: Serum levels of Tie-2, Ang-2, VEGF-A and VEGFR1 were significantly increased in CCHF patients compared with the HC. Furthermore, serum Tie-2, Ang-2, VEGF and VEGFR1 levels were found to be significantly higher in the severe group than in the nonsevere and HC groups (P < 0.05 and P < 0.001, respectively). Also, Tie-2, Ang-2, VEGF-A and VEGFR1 levels were significantly higher in the nonsevere group than in the HC group (P < 0.05). CONCLUSION: Having statistically significant higher Ang-2, Tie-2, VEGF-A and VEGFR1 levels in the severe group when compared with the other groups suggested that VEGF-related Ang-2/Tie-2 system played a critical role in the pathogenesis of the disease, and these markers could be used as the severity criteria.

BACKGROUND: Apoptosis is a main regulator in responses of cellular immunity throughout systemic viral infections. Perforin, soluble Fas ligand, caspase-3 and caspase-cleaved cytokeratin-18 (M-30) are mediators of apoptosis. The aim of this study is the evaluation of Crimean-Congo hemorrhagic fever (CCHF) disease changes in the levels of these apoptotic markers and the relation of these changes with disease severity. METHODS: Forty-nine hospitalized children with CCHF and 36 healthy controls were enrolled in this prospective study. The CCHF patients were classified into 2 groups based on disease severity (severe group and nonsevere group). Demographic characteristics and clinical and laboratory findings of all patients were recorded on admission. RESULTS: Serum perforin, caspase-3 and soluble Fas ligand levels were found to be significantly higher both in the severe and nonsevere CCHF groups than the healthy control group (P < 0.05), but there was no significant difference in these apoptotic markers between severe and nonsevere CCHF groups (P > 0.05). In addition, serum M-30 levels did not differ significantly among all groups (P > 0.05). There was a positive correlation between serum values for perforin, caspase-3 and M-30 and the disease's severity criteria such as aspartate aminotransferase and/or alanine aminotransferase. The serum levels of all these markers were negatively correlated with disease severity criteria such as the platelet count. CONCLUSIONS: In this study, we concluded that the interactions of cytolytic granules containing perforin and caspase cascade and Fas-FasL may play an important role in the pathogenesis of CCHF in children.
